Output f7ef57156631e549fb83130bd2325e9b203195869353ddd1e714b86405a36e36:34

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 16c2d3b9106fb5f2f1d980f5c16cc813f9d383b5
address
tb1qzmpd8wgsd76l9uwesr6uzmxgz0ua8qa45wtx8a
transaction
f7ef57156631e549fb83130bd2325e9b203195869353ddd1e714b86405a36e36
confirmations
26073
spent
true